The based membrane extraction of Th 4+ and Yb 3+ was studied in HBTMPP heptane using a hollow fibber membrane. The separation method of Th 4+ and Yb 3+ was proposed by kinetics competition. The separation operation of Th 4+ and Yb 3+ mixture was carried out by two successive extraction and stripping simultaneously. The concentration ratio of Th 4+ to Yb 3+ is 16 74 in the stripping solution. The recovery and purity of Th 4+ are 71 6% and 95 74% respectively.
